遮荫强度对南方红豆杉苗木质量影响的研究 被引量:7

Effects of Shading Degree on Seedling Quality of Taxux chinenwsis var. mairei

摘要 采取不同遮荫强度及时间,对南方红豆杉苗木进行培育试验。结果表明:遮荫50%,夏季和早秋全遮荫6 h,对培育3~4年生苗木有利;遮荫度70%~90%,且在夏季和早秋全天遮荫,对培育1年生苗木有利;遮荫70%,且在夏季和早秋全天遮荫,对培育2年生苗木效果显著。 Using different shading degrees and lasting time to conduct cultural experiments of Taxux chinenwsis var.mairei,the results showed that shading 6 hours in the summer and early autumn was favorable to 3~4 year-old seedlings;shade degree of 70%~90% and shading full-time in the summer and early autumn was favorable to one-year-old seedlings;shading degree of 70% and shading full-time in the summer and early autumn was favorable to biennial seedlings significantly.According to these results,the seeding cultivation methods for Taxux chinenwsis var.mairei were summarized.
